Sympl is a payment method that enables Egyptian bank card holders (especially debit cards or credit cards) to buy now and pay later on 3, 4, or 5 payments with no interest, no application process, no pre-registration, and no waiting time for approval. Just pay the service fee and down payment requested to complete the purchase in less than 10 seconds. Nothing is required other than your Egyptian bank card (debit or credit), your national ID card, and choose to pay later with Sympl as a payment method at checkout with the condition of having an available card balance that covers the full transaction amount.
Sympl’s terms and conditions
- The card balance has to cover the full transaction amount; however, we do not hold the amount on the card.
- The customer has to present his national ID card while checking out and the name on NID card has to match the name on card.
- The minimum transaction amount is EGP300 and the maximum is EGP30,000 t
- The down payment is determined according to Sympl’s criteria, so it varies form one customer to the other and from one card to the other.
- The customer has to sign on both copies of the receipt (customer’s copy and merchant’s copy)
- The customer pays the down payment and service fee displayed during purchase using his bank card used in the transaction and not in cash.
- All payments are automatically deducted on their due dates from the customer’s bank card used in the transaction.The merchant can process full or partial refunds from the POS machine.
- In case of full refunds, the service fee cannot be refunded back to the customer if the refund took place after 72 hours from purchase date.
- Minimum down payment that is calculated depending on each customer and each card upon checkout and displayed during purchase.
- As for the fees, the customer pays a one-time service fee on every purchase which varies between EGP100 and EGP200 also displayed during purchase
- The down payment and service fee are paid through direct debit from the customer’s bank card used during purchase
- You can use Sympl with Egyptian bank cards only (debit or credit cards)
- Any return/exchange for a Sympl transaction is processed according to the IKEA’s refund and exchange policy so you need to contact the IKEA and request the refund/exchange

- Souhoola & Ikea offer will be as follows :
0% installment plan :
Interest : 0%
Tenor(months) : 6 months or 9 months or 12 months
Admin Fees: 10% (for 6 months ) , 12% (for 9 months) , 15% (for( 12 months)
Down payment: 0%
Other plans :
Interest : 18% flat annual
Tenor(months) : From 18 to 60 months
Admin Fees: 5%
Down payment: 0%
